Key Properties
−| Expression System | Human Cells |
|---|---|
| Biological Origin | Human |
| Biological Activity | ELISA: Immobilized Human PD-L1-Flag(Cat#orb2994368) at 2μg/ml (100 μl/well)can bind Anti-Human PDL1 mAb-Fc(Cat#orb2993144).The ED50 of Anti-Human PDL1 mAb-Fc(Cat#orb2993144) is 14.68 ng/ml.. BLI: Loaded Human PD-1-Fc(Cat#orb2994333) on Protein A Biosensor, can bind Human PD-L1-Flag(Cat#orb2994368) with an affinity constant of 0.19 uM as determined in BLI assay. |
| Tag | C-Flag |
| Molecular Weight | Predicted: 26.3 KDa. Observed: 35-40 KDa, reducing conditions |
| Expression Region | Phe19-Thr239 |
| Purity | SDS-PAGE: Greater than 95% as determined by reducing SDS-PAGE. |
| Endotoxins | < 1 EU/µg as determined by LAL test. |
| Conjugation | Unconjugated |
Storage & Handling
−| Storage | Lyophilized protein should be stored at ≤ -20°C, stable for one year after receipt. Reconstituted protein solution can be stored at 2-8°C for 2-7 days. Aliquots of reconstituted samples are stable at ≤ -20°C for 3 months. |
|---|---|
| Form/Appearance | Lyophilized from a 0.2 μm filtered solution of 20mM PB, 150mM NaCl, pH 7.4. |
| Reconstitution | Always centrifuge tubes before opening.Do not mix by vortex or pipetting. It is not recommended to reconstitute to a concentration less than 100μg/ml. Dissolve the lyophilized protein in distilled water. Please aliquot the reconstituted solution to minimize freeze-thaw cycles. |
